Foxtable(狐表)用户栏目专家坐堂 → 导出txt符号去除


  共有2738人关注过本帖树形打印复制链接

主题:导出txt符号去除

帅哥哟,离线,有人找我吗?
luodang2050
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:585 积分:5674 威望:0 精华:0 注册:2014/5/21 10:30:00
导出txt符号去除  发帖心情 Post By:2014/5/24 13:00:00 [只看该作者]

如题,导出表格某一字段“网址”,但是导出后所有值都带双引号“”,请问怎么去除呢?

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2014/5/24 13:03:00 [只看该作者]

测试没这个问题,是否你本身就有双引号.

 回到顶部
帅哥哟,离线,有人找我吗?
luodang2050
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:585 积分:5674 威望:0 精华:0 注册:2014/5/21 10:30:00
  发帖心情 Post By:2014/5/24 13:09:00 [只看该作者]

值如下,导出结果网址总是加双引号
http://www.szjsjy.com.cn/BusinessInfo/JYXXDetails.aspx?gcbh=4403002012062007&flag=Hyxx&close=yes
以下是代码:
If FileSys.FileExists("D:\Personal\Desktop\市内交易关注网址.txt") Then
    'Messagebox.Show("文件已经存在!","提示")
    FileSys.DeleteFile("D:\Personal\Desktop\市内交易关注网址.txt",2,2) '则彻底删除之
Else
    ' Messagebox.Show("文件不存在或已经被删除!","提示")
End If
Dim ex As New Exporter
ex.SourceTableName = "ZBGG_SNJY_SG_GZ" '指定导出表
'ex.Filter=
ex.Fields="链接网址"
ex.FilePath = "D:\Personal\Desktop\" '指定目标文件路径
ex.Format = "Delimited" '导出格式为符号分割的文本文件
ex.NewTableName = "市内交易关注网址" '指定文件名,注意无须扩展名
ex.Header = 0
ex.Export() '开始导出

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2014/5/24 14:28:00 [只看该作者]

用代码导出确实如此,用系统菜单没问题.

或者你可以用如下代码.

Dim s As String =DataTables("a").GetComboListString("链接网址").Replace("|",vbcrlf)
FileSys.WriteAllText("C:\abc\室内交易关注网址.txt",s,False)

 回到顶部
帅哥哟,离线,有人找我吗?
luodang2050
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:585 积分:5674 威望:0 精华:0 注册:2014/5/21 10:30:00
  发帖心情 Post By:2014/5/24 15:00:00 [只看该作者]

用超版这代码又简洁,又灵活,收藏了,谢谢

 回到顶部